Hi guys, I have a kitty that just won’t come out of my bedroom for fear of my dog. Even when I remove him so I want to make a gym that I can set up on my triple dresser for her to play on.
I don’t need plans (although that would be nice) but I could use a pic of any that you may have hand made or store bought I have a few ideas but would like others’. I don’t mind if it takes up the entire dresser.
